About Toronto Zoo

The Toronto Zoo spans large, naturalistic habitats and regions that showcase animals from around the world, from polar bears and primates to reptiles and birds. It focuses on conservation, education and species protection, with many exhibits designed to replicate animals’ native environments. Visitors can plan a full day here—there are dining facilities, a splash pad seasonally, a carousel and seasonal events. Because the site is large, comfortable footwear and advance ticket planning (including shuttles from Union Station at busy times) are recommended.
